Many major steels reported earn Ings considerably above the de pressed first Quarter last year buttressed the increasing Cost Price squeeze and the deed for govern ment Aid through liberalized depreciation. Statements by government officials added to the Market s woe. Treasury Secretary Douglas gluon asked or business tax credit legis lation to guard against a possible business downturn in 1963, and Commerce Secretary Luther Hodges warned that the president might act against the aluminium Industry As he did against steel it the Light Metal makers also try to raise prices. Despite All this there was enough cheer in the business and economic picture to make it hard for the analysts to account for the extent of the decline. First Quarter earnings for most companies showed a big bulge Over the initial period last year new car sales and machine tool order increased and March construction contracts were estimated at a All time High for the month. Be Many of the analysts co wrong for so Long about the trend of the Market were More timid than usual about forecasting the course of stocks this week. Although Many were hoping that Friday climactic bust had put the Market Back into position for at least technical rally few were betting on it. In the Dow Jones averages industrials were off 22,05 to ?72.20, rails fell 5.10 to 138.76, Utt Litie 0.79to 128,77, and 65 stocks 6.38 to 232.48. Trading for the period was the highest in two months and included the first 4-Milllon share Day since mid february. Turnover last week was 17,424,4 shares com pared with 13,458,120 in the prior Holiday week and 22,400,970 in the like 1961 period. Most Active . The action was taken without dissent As the Senate approved a list of military nominations. Goldwater an Active Pilot who to checked out in some of the air Force s most advanced Jet planes was a brigadier general. He was not present when the Senate acted. His office said he was in Phoenix praised by Dirksen Senate Republican Leader Everett m. Dirksen of Illinois praised Goldwater s faithful serv ice.
